What would be a good 1-day itinerary for visiting in and around Kildare?
A good day trip could start with a visit to the Irish National Stud and Japanese Gardens in Kildare town. Then, head to the Curragh, Ireland's premier racecourse, for a spot of lunch and a tour. Finish the day with a visit to the historic Kildare Cathedral and its impressive architecture.

Can you easily explore Kildare on foot or by bike?
Kildare town itself is quite compact and easy to explore on foot. For exploring the wider area, hiring a bike is a good option, especially for cycling along the Grand Canal or through the scenic countryside.

What activities are available in and around Kildare?
There's plenty to do in Kildare! You can enjoy horse racing at the Curragh, explore the Irish National Stud and Japanese Gardens, shop at Kildare Village, or go for a walk or cycle along the Grand Canal. For a bit of history, visit Kildare Cathedral or the Newbridge Museum of Style Icons.
